The cartoonist, journalist and painter Andrés Vázquez de Sola, symbol of the anti-Franco struggle, died in Granada

He was close to reaching the century mark, but he stayed at 97, which is also a long life. In his case, moreover, eventful and full of vicissitudes. Andres Vazquez de Sola He died in the early hours of Thursday, September 26, as announced by his relatives and later confirmed by the San Roque town hall.

He was born in 1927 in Saint-Roch (Cádiz). In the capital of Cádiz, coincidentally, the Alcances festival begins today, which includes a documentary about his figure: “The ideology of pencils, a brushstroke of the life of Vázquez de Sola”. An appropriate title because this cartoonist, painter and journalist is inseparable from politics.

Although he began studying theology in Grenadehe left because it was clear that it was not his calling. He began working for the defunct newspaper Patria and gradually delved deeper into communist ideology. He received the card of the then banned Spanish Communist Party in 1960.

He also appeared in the Madrid newspaper and on Spanish television, but his speech continued troubles with censorship They took him to France where, after going through many difficulties – it is said that he literally slept under the bridges of the Seine – he joined the satirical newspaper Le Canard Enchainé.

It was his consecration. His criticism of the Franco regime increased the distribution and reached the million copies. His signature and his drawings also appear in important media such as Le Monde or Le Monde Diplomatique, but he is not limited to developing his role as a designer but also promotes his career as a painter.

He returned to Spain in 1985 and from his house in Monachil, near Granada, he prepared works in homage to gArcía Lorca, Francisco Ayala or Miguel Hernández. But he retained his ties to his hometown. The San Roque town hall has in fact declared three days of official mourning.
